In an unfortunate incident, several Class 10 students on their way to the exam centre for the annual matriculation exam, sustained injuries after the vehicle carrying them overturned mid-way. The condition of one girl student is stated to be critical, depriving her of the exam.
The shocking incident has been reported from Krushnanagar under Rajnagar block in Kendrapara district.
According to sources, as many as 11 students were en route to their exam center in an SUV. The tragic mishap occurred after the driver lost balance on the wheels and hit a cyclist on the road. While the cyclist was killed on the spot, the students sustained critical injuries. The deceased cyclist has been identified as Subrat Mandal.
The condition of one of the students remains critical, reports said.
Meanwhile, the Odisha Class 10 board examinations that commenced today will conclude on March 6, 2025. The board exam kicked off today with the First Language paper that will be followed by Second Language on February 23, Mathematics on February 26, Third Language on February 28, Science on March 4, and concluding with Social Science on March 6.
This year, the BSE Odisha has implemented stringent measures to ensure the smooth conduct of examinations and prevent any malpractices. Special arrangements have been made to safeguard against question paper leaks, including the use of sealed question papers and strict protocols for their distribution.
The board has also deployed flying squads and static surveillance teams to monitor exam centers. Additionally, CCTV cameras have been installed at sensitive locations to maintain the integrity of the examination process.
